Bloomberg stands as a titan in the realm of financial news, renowned for its comprehensive coverage and real-time data. Beyond its news articles, Bloomberg offers the Bloomberg Terminal, a powerful tool used by professionals worldwide.

  • Provides in-depth analysis on global markets, economies, and industries
  • Offers real-time data on stocks, commodities, currencies, and more
  • Features multimedia content, including videos and podcasts
  • The Bloomberg Terminal offers advanced analytics and trading tools (subscription-based)

TipRanks is a unique platform that aggregates analyst ratings and financial blogger opinions, providing a consensus view on stocks. It offers tools to assess the credibility of financial experts.

  • Aggregated analyst ratings and stock forecasts
  • Performance tracking of financial experts and bloggers
  • Smart Score system to evaluate stock potential
  • Tools for portfolio management and investment research

Investopedia is a comprehensive resource for financial education, offering articles, tutorials, and investment tools. It's particularly useful for those looking to build their financial literacy.

  • Extensive financial dictionary and educational articles
  • Tutorials on investing, trading, and personal finance
  • Simulated trading platform for practice
  • Quizzes and exams to test financial knowledge
